Psalm 147:18 (MSG), "Then he gives the command and it all melts; he breathes on winter - suddenly it's spring!"

Thursday... This is another of his wonders.

I am sitting here in my morning coffee shop and looking out the window at one of the wonders of God, the trees have leaves all over them. It seems that the last time I had really looked, there were no leaves. The leaves knew when to come out.


It was great to see and then I read Psalm 147:18 (MSG), and it said, "Then he gives the command and it all melts; he breathes on winter - suddenly it's spring!" Oh what a God we serve. He really does know what he is doing.

Verse 15 in the Amplified Bible says, "He sends His command to the earth; His word runs very swiftly."

Verses 3-5 (NLT) says, "He heals the brokenhearted and bandages their wounds. He counts the stars and calls them all by name. How great is our Lord! His power is absolute! His understanding is beyond comprehension!" And he covers the trees with leaves just at the right time, "suddenly it's spring!"

And the writer starts this Psalm in verse 1 by saying, "Praise the Lord! How good to sing praises to our God! How delightful and how fitting." And he ends this Psalm by saying, "Praise the Lord!"

No matter what we are going through he knows what he is doing.

And verses 10 & 11 says, "He takes no pleasure in the strength of a horse or in human might. No, the Lord delights in those who fear him, those who put their hope in his unfailing loves." And that is another of his wonders. "Praise the Lord!" Yes, yes! #todaysvbeginning
